Tag: Le Marche

  • Wow it’s nearly November!

    Incredible, it is nearly November where has this year gone??? We are in the last few days of October so first thing to say is Happy Birthday to us at 2 duck trading co – we are 15 years old!! It was a quite a life changing moment when we took over 2 duck trading…